Overview of the EB5 Program
The EB5 Immigrant Investor Program serves as an important path for foreign nationals looking for united state permanent residency through financial investment. Established by the Immigration Act of 1990, the program aims to stimulate the united state economy by drawing in international financial investment and producing jobs. It provides capitalists the possibility to obtain a Permit for themselves and their prompt member of the family by investing a substantial quantity of funding in a new company that will certainly profit the united state economy.The program requires a minimum financial investment of $1 million in a company, or $500,000 if the financial investment is made in a targeted employment area (TEA), which is specified as a backwoods or a location with high joblessness. Financiers need to demonstrate that their investment will certainly produce or maintain a minimum of 10 full time tasks for united state workers within a two-year period.The EB5 program has amassed interest as a result of its potential for expedited residency and the opportunity to live, work, and study in the USA. It likewise allows capitalists to maintain their existing service rate of interests in their home countries while going after residency in the U.S. The program operates via regional facilities, which are assigned by USCIS and facilitate the financial investment process by pooling funds from numerous capitalists into bigger projects.As an outcome, the EB5 Immigrant Investor Program not only acts as a practical migration path but additionally plays a substantial function in advertising financial development across numerous markets in the United States.

The Application Process
Guiding the application procedure for the EB5 Immigrant Capitalist Program calls for cautious attention to information and a full understanding of the demands involved. The procedure generally starts with choosing an ideal EB5 task, which should fulfill the program's standards of work production and investment minimums - EB5 Immigrant Investor Program. Prospective capitalists should after that dedicate a minimum investment of $1 million, or $500,000 if purchasing a targeted work area (TEA) As soon as a job is chosen, the financier must prepare and send Kind I-526, the Immigrant Petition by Alien Investor. This type requires in-depth paperwork, consisting of evidence of the financial investment funding's authorized resource, a thorough business strategy, and evidence that the job will certainly develop at the very least 10 permanent work for U.S. workers. It is important to verify that all information is accurate and total to avoid delays.After sending Kind I-526, the investor should wait for authorization from U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) If authorized, the financier and qualified relative can get conditional permanent residency through Type I-485, Change of Status, or by getting an immigrant visa at a united state consulate abroad.Upon acquiring conditional residency, the capitalist needs to file Form I-829 to get rid of conditions on their residency within the two-year duration. This action likewise requires demonstrating that the investment has satisfied the task development demand. Comprehensive preparation and adherence to timelines are important to browse the EB5 application process effectively
Common Difficulties
Steering via the EB5 Immigrant Capitalist Program can offer a number of obstacles that prospective financiers ought to be mindful of. One of the primary difficulties is the intricacy of the application process. Investors should navigate a diverse landscape of paperwork, including proof of the authorized source of funds, company plans, and task practicality. This complexity commonly requires the support of lawful and financial experts, which can raise costs.Another significant difficulty is the requirement for task creation. The program mandates that an EB5 financial investment need to create or maintain at the very least 10 full-time jobs for U.S. employees. This requirement can be specifically daunting for capitalists that may lack experience in examining job market dynamics and the financial practicality of proposed projects.Additionally, the shifting governing landscape poses dangers to possible capitalists. Changes in immigration policies or EB5 program laws can influence the timeline for obtaining a Permit or the qualification of certain jobs. Keeping abreast of these developments is important but can be time-consuming and stressful.Investors likewise encounter the challenge of finding trustworthy Regional Centers. Not all facilities provide the exact same degree of openness or job high quality, and due persistance is necessary to assure that investments are audio and compliant with EB5 demands.
